nach upgrade 4.2 -> 4.3 clients fehlen

Antworten
opsi_neuling
Beiträge: 6
Registriert: 17 Apr 2014, 11:30

nach upgrade 4.2 -> 4.3 clients fehlen

Beitrag von opsi_neuling »

Hallo miteinander,
nach ziehmlich nahtlosen upgrade 4.2 -> 4.3 (Centos, RPM) haben wir festgestellt dass ein paar Client's (>30 von ~300) fehlen (upgrade import auf mysql?)
gibts es die Möglichkeit sie nachzutragen/importieren, etc ohne eine neue Installation der betroffenen Clients ?
Die Clients sind identifiziert, original .ini und pckeys sind vorhanden ...
ich freue mich für Tips und Tricks,

Vielen dank im Voraus...
Benutzeravatar
fkalweit
uib-Team
Beiträge: 182
Registriert: 23 Okt 2020, 16:14

Re: nach upgrade 4.2 -> 4.3 clients fehlen

Beitrag von fkalweit »

Hallo,

könnten du uns evt das File-Backend zur Verfügung stellen?
Ich schicke dir einen Link zu unsere Nextcloud als PN.

Dann können wir mal schauen, ob da ein generelles Problem besteht.

Vielen Dank und viele Grüße aus Mainz,
Fabian
opsi_neuling
Beiträge: 6
Registriert: 17 Apr 2014, 11:30

Re: nach upgrade 4.2 -> 4.3 clients fehlen

Beitrag von opsi_neuling »

Hi Fabian,
ich habe etwas raus gefunden.
die clients die ignoriert wurden, haben eine duplikate mac addresse gehabt.
ich vermute, wir haben irgendwann die clients kopiert...
Hier ist was ich meinte ....

z.b.
/var/lib/opsi/config/clients/client1.ini
[info]
..
hardwareaddress = 52:54:00:C6:19:01
..
/var/lib/opsi/config/clients/client2.ini
[info]
..
hardwareaddress = 52:54:00:C6:19:01
..
Das ist die Ursache warum nicht importiert worden sind.

Es bleibt nur die Frage.
Kann ich ein import für die fehlende Clients irgendwie neu laufen lassen ?
vg
Benutzeravatar
fkalweit
uib-Team
Beiträge: 182
Registriert: 23 Okt 2020, 16:14

Re: nach upgrade 4.2 -> 4.3 clients fehlen

Beitrag von fkalweit »

Hi,

man könnte die Daten nochmal neu übernehmen und in der /etc/opsi/backends/mysql.conf
"unique_hardware_addresses": False setzen.

Dann würdet ihr aber alle Änderung seid dem Update verlieren.

Ich frage mal bei uns nach, ob es evt ein Script oder eine andere Möglichkeit für diesen Fall gibt.

Viele Grüße
Fabian
Andreas T.
Beiträge: 15
Registriert: 10 Mai 2015, 17:38

Re: nach upgrade 4.2 -> 4.3 clients fehlen

Beitrag von Andreas T. »

Wir haben auch 9 Clients auf diese Weise verloren. Es wäre schön, wenn wir diese aus den .ini Dateien neu importieren könnten ohne etwas an den restlichen Clients zu verändern.
Benutzeravatar
fkalweit
uib-Team
Beiträge: 182
Registriert: 23 Okt 2020, 16:14

Re: nach upgrade 4.2 -> 4.3 clients fehlen

Beitrag von fkalweit »

Hallo,

wir haben dafür aktuell keinen Automatismus. Man könnte zB ein python Script schreiben, dass die ini-Dateien lesen kann und die Daten per API in opsi aufnimmt. Auch möglich wäre auf einem Testserver die alten Daten einspielen, dann mit dem Configed die Clients zu exportieren und auf dem produktiven Server wieder über den configed zu importieren.
Mit neuen opsiconfd Versionen sollte das auch nicht mehr passieren.

Viele Grüße
Fabian
Antworten